Having a water heater that’s as well big or as well little is one of the main reasons for greater energy costs. Typically, a 30-gallon storage tank suffices for 2 people, a 40-gallon storage tank is good for 3-4 people, and also a 50-gallon tank suits 4-5 people. While tankless water heaters run extra efficiently than storage tank water heaters, changing a tank water heater with a tankless can be costly, and also the payback time can be longer than the guarantee. So, If you have a guarantee of 12 to 15 years, which is normal, it does not make monetary feeling to change a tank water heater with a tankless water heater.

If you do not understand the age of your current device, look for a producer tag on the side of your water heater– this ought to include the setup date. If the tag is missing out on, or the setup date is not noted, you can use the identification number to determine the age of your device. Identification number formats differ by manufacturer, with the setup date placed in a different way in each situation. Examine the brand on your water heater and then google the brand name and also identification number to determine the age of your device. The sound is triggered by debris gathering in the bottom of the heater. As a result of the warm water gurgling up, via the debris, in the bottom of the storage tank. When this takes place, it triggers a standing out sound. 2 ways to prevent it: 1) Flush your water heater out regularly. Empty it, open the cold water intake and also fill the water storage tank halfway while enabling the stream of the water to rinse the debris from inside the storage tank. Empty the water via the drain valve and also repeat the procedure until you do not see any indications of debris left in the storage tank. 2) Mount a water conditioner in your home. The water conditioner will eliminate the debris that develops in your storage tank.
If ELECTRIC, initially, reset any tripped breaker and also change any blown fuse. Next off, push the water heater reset button(s). Somewhere on your electric water heater, you’ll locate a reset button. It’s usually red and also frequently situated near the thermostat. It might also be hidden behind a detachable steel panel on the device– and then behind some insulation. When you locate the button, push and also release it. While you have the accessibility panel off, see if there’s a 2nd thermostat and also 2nd reset button. If the button trips again promptly after you push it, something’s not working correctly, and also you ought to require among our ninja-plumbers.

Water Heater Quit Working
When there’s no warm water, the issue can stem from absence of power, a malfunctioning electric thermostat or a malfunctioning top electric burner. Beginning by dismissing power issues. Initially, reset any tripped breaker, and also change any blown fuse. Next off, check if power is being provided to the electric water burner thermostat. Test the element, and also if it’s malfunctioning, change it. Finally, if the thermostat is receiving power but is still not working, change it or the electric water burner. Water Heater vs Boiler
A water heater is a large storage tank that, you presumed it, warms water. The warmth is either produced by melting gas or by making use of electricity. A central heating boiler, on the other hand, can warm water that is used to bring warmth to the house and also warmth the water. Central heating boilers are really versatile heating systems that give you terrific convenience during the cool winter months. Today’s boilers are also really energy efficient. Shut off the water! If you experience a leaking water heater, it is recommended to shut off the water to your storage tank. Your water heater storage tank ought to have a dedicated shutoff valve on the cool inlet pipes. If this is a gate-style valve (a wheel that turns), turn the valve clockwise regarding you can. If the valve is a ball-style valve, turn the deal with 180 levels. Call us for aid at 877-814-9725 If the valve is damaged, you can shut the water off to your house. Each house must have a major water shut off valve that would certainly stop the flow of water to the entire home. When an electrical warm water heater's elements short out or melt via, cool water is the result. Commonly, the reduced element goes first, but that's not constantly the situation. Luckily, a couple of quick electric tests expose which element you have to change in order to bring back warm water to your house.

Water Heater Runs Out Of Warm Water Promptly: Feasible Reasons Why. As mentioned over, numerous things can create a residence's warm water supply to run out faster than it should. The 3 most common wrongdoers are debris develop, a malfunctioning burner and also a damaged dip tube.
Hot water should last just a couple of minutes and then only cold water would certainly be appearing. So the issue, specifically with older water heaters is quite common. So, if your water heater is "of a specific age" chances are you have actually got a damaged or disintegrated dip tube and also you require to change it.

Water heaters ought to not be placed straight on the "dust," but they can (definitely) be set up at floor level with no risk of "blowing up." The Uniform Plumbing Code, which develops requirements nationwide, says that the flame or triggering device in a gas water heater have to be at least 18 inches off the ground.
There are a variety of reasons that your water heater can explode; nonetheless, the main reason behind water heater surges is stress. Anything that triggers excess stress on your water heating system, such as a bad anode rod, or a great deal of debris build-up, can all create your water heater to take off.
